We report a new hydrogen flame synthesis method to successfully grow graphene on h-BN flakes in 20 seconds without using any catalyst. At the initial stage graphene layers anchored to the ((1) over bar 100) surface plane of the h-BN crystal, and afterwards the graphene grew up beyond substrates to form high electrical conductivity quasi-freestanding nanosheets.
